Re: Makeup can age the skin

Now it is being substantiated. Using makeup on the face, particularly oil based ones can clog the skin pores leading to acne and pimples. It can also aggravate fine lines below and around eyes, which is a sign of aging. Talc based make up products when used, cause dryness of skin and early and more rapid wrinkling.9 Oct 2017

The makeup and environmental pollutants you accumulate during the day seep into your pores, breaking down collagen and elastin. This can speed up the ageing process and leave you with fine lines and wrinkles. Cleanse and moisturize your skin every night before bed.
